Givat Hnanya - Abu Tor אבו טור - גבעת חנניה - Neighborhood of Jerusalem






Abu Tor  now renamed Givat Hnanya,  situated to the south of the old city of Jerusalem. 

Divided by the Armistice Line between the years 1948 to 1967.  

To the west, Abu Tor was governed by the Israelis, to the East, the Jordanians. 

Unified under Israeli rule, the neighborhood remains divided, now by a road between the Jewish quarter on the upper slopes of the hill and the Arab quarter on the lower slopes.  (Real Estate prices are high on either side).

Jerusalem - Bird Observatory - התחנה לחקר ציפורי ירושלים - May 2011


The Jerusalem - Bird Observatory is a study and research center for the understanding of, and conservation of birds.

In this 5,000 square meters sanctuary, birds are monitored through a ringing and observation process.  Data on the migration, behavior and physical properties of the birds is collected and studied.

The JBO is Located in the center of Jerusalem and borders the  Knesset and the Supreme Court gardens,  Open to the public.. (see link below).

Givatayim - גבעתיים



Givatayim -  גבעתיים, a City built on 3 hills -  Tel Aviv District. Givatayim shares it's borders with Tel Aviv and Ramat Gan.

Established in the late 50s.

Early Buildings are of the Modern Movement.

There is evidence that earliest residents of Givatayim lived here during the Chalcolithic Period -4000 - 3300 BCE (Copper and Stone Age)
